An essential part of Word's citations and bibliography feature is the Source Manager dialog - here's how to, er, manage the Source Manager. Open the Source Manager from References | Citations and Bibliography | Manage Sources. There is a Current List (at right) which is saved in the current document. Edit a source. On the References tab, in the Citations & Bibliography group, click Manage Sources. In the Source Manager dialog box, under Master List or Current List, select the source you want to edit, and then click Edit. … In the Edit Source dialog box, make the changes you want and click OK.11 Apr 2016 ...
